Veggie Nest


Ingredients

Carrot,Peas,Beans,Potato - 1 cup(each 1/4 cup)
Onion                               - 1/4 cup
Mint & Coriander Leaves  - 2 tblsp
Green Chilli                      - 1
Ginger Garlic Paste          - 1 tsp
Garam Masala                  - 1/2 tsp
Corn Flour                       - 1 tblsp
Bread Crumbs                 - 2 tblsp
Vermicelli                        - 1/4 cup
Salt                                 - to taste
Oil                                  - to deep fry

Method

  • Cook the chopped vegetables with salt.Add all other ingredients excluding oil and mix well.Divide into small portions.
               
       

  • Make it oblong and roll it in vermicelli and deep fry till golden brown turning gently.
                
       

Little Words

  • An appealing snack for kids.Serve with sauce or just plain.
  • Tastes best when hot.
  • Let the flame be medium.

Tomato Kuruma

Ingredients

Tomato               - 3
Onion                  - 1 
Chilli Powder       - 3/4 tsp
Turmeric Powder - 1/4 tsp
Mustard Seeds     - to splutter
Curry Leaves       - few
Coriander Leaves - 1 tblsp 
Salt                      - to taste 
Oil                       - 2 tsp
To Grind
Coconut              - 1/4 cup 
Fried Gram          -  2 tblsp
Aniseed               - 3/4 tsp
Khus Khus          - 1/2 tsp
Clove                  - 2
Cinnamon            - a small piece

Method

  • Add required water to the ingredients to grind and grind it to a paste.
     
  • Heat oil in a pan,splutter mustard seeds,add curry leaves,onion and saute till onion becomes soft.Add the chopped tomatoes and saute.
        
  • Now add turmeric powder,chilli powder,salt and saute for a while till tomatoes are mushy.Add the coconut paste to this and adjust water level.Bring this to a boil,garnish with coriander leaves and serve.
             
       
Little Words

  • A great combo for idli and especially dosa.(I always eat extra dosas with this kuruma).

Jeera Pepper Potato Fry

Ingredients

Potato               -  3
Jeera Powder    -  1/2 tsp
Pepper Powder  - 1/2 tsp
Salt                   - to taste
Oil                    - 1 tblsp
Coriander leaves- to garnish

Method

  • Cut potato into small cubes and cook in a pan of salted boiling water for ten minutes.Drain and add pepper powder and mix.
        
  • Heat oil in a shallow frying pan and add the poatao cubes.Sprinkle jeera powder and toss it gently.
        
  • Fry this over medium flame tossing gently till golden brown on all sides.Garnish with coriander leaves and serve.
        

Little Words

  • Do not overcook the potatoes.It may get mushy.
  • Sprinkle little more salt while frying if needed.
  • Nice combo with sambhar,rasam,curd...
  • Roast a teaspoon of jeera and grind it to fine powder to get fresh powder.

Spinach Sweetcorn Fritters/Spinach Corn Vadai

Ingredients

Channa dal          -  1/2 cup
Sweetcorn           -  1/2 cup
Green Chilli          -  1
Onion                  - 1
Ginger                 - 1"piece
Spinach                - 1/2 cup
Coriander Leaves - 1/4 cup
Curry Leaves       - few
Aniseed               - 1/2 tsp
Khus Khus          - 1/4 tsp
Salt                     - to taste
Oil                      - to deep fry

Method

  • Soak channa dal for half an hour and grind it along with aniseed,khus khus,ginger,chilli,curry leaves and salt.
        
  • Add all other ingredients and mix well.Make small balls,flatten gently between palms and deep fry in hot oil till golden brown.
                 
                
        

Little Words

  • An excellent teatime snack crunchy outside and soft inside.
  • I added one tablespoon of gramflour since the mixture was a little watery after adding greens.
  • You can use either fresh or frozen corn.
  • Yellow split peas can be used instead of channa dal.

Coleslaw

 Ingredients

Cabbage          - 1/4 cup
Carrot              - 1/4 cup
Mayonnaise      - 1 tblsp
Yoghurt            - 2 tblsp
Raisins              - 1 tblsp
Peanuts             - 1 tblsp(roasted)
Honey               - 1 tblsp
Onion                - 1 tblsp(optional)
Pepper powder - to taste

Method

  • Mix all the ingredients together in a bowl and serve.
               
        

Little Words

  • A healthy salad.Kids may not like this but keep trying.Add more raisins and peanuts to make it appealing for kids.

Aloo Channa

Ingredients

Chickpeas           -  1/2 cup(soaked overnight or for 6 hrs)
Potato                 -  1
Onion                  -  1
Curry Leaves       - few
Mustard Seeds     - to splutter
Coriander Leaves -  to garnish
Chilli Powder        - 1/2 tsp
Salt                      - to taste
Oil                       - 2 tsp

Method

  • Pressure cook chickpeas and potato for two whistles with little salt.
  • Heat oil in a pan,splutter mustard seeds,add onion,cuury leaves and fry till onion becomes translucent.Add chilli powder,little salt and sprinkle water (to avoid burning).
       
  • Now add the cooked chickpeas and potato,give it a mix,garnish with coriander leaves and serve.
       
Little Words

  • If you want to have chunks of potato then add it to onions and let it cook and then add cooked chickpeas.
  • Or boil potatoes separately and add it .
  • A healthy snack for kids.
  • This can be made like a chaat too.
  • Other masalas can be added to make spicy masala aloo channa.

Salmon Fish Bites

Ingredients

Salmon  Fillets       -  2
Tomato Ketchup    -  1 tblsp
Chilli Powder         -  3/4 tsp
Ginger Garlic Paste -  1 tblsp
Coriander Powder -  1 tblsp
Cumin Powder      -  1/2 tsp
Lemon Juice          -  1 tblsp
Salt                       - to taste
Oil                        - to shallow fry

Method

  • Mix tomato ketchup,chilli powder,ginger garlic paste,coriander powder,cumin powder,salt and lemon juice.
         
  • Cut the fish into pieces.You can use any desired variety.
       
  • Apply the masala over the fish pieces and shallow fry till golden brown on both sides.
                 
        
  • Squeeze in some lime juice and serve with onion rings.

Little Words

  • You can apply this masala for other fish varieties too.
  • While shallow frying let the flame be medium.
